Understanding Business Registration Requirements

Every business must determine whether GST registration is mandatory based on turnover, business type, and supply location. Registering at the right time ensures legal invoicing and smooth customer transactions. Delayed registration can lead to penalties and loss of credibility with clients and vendors.

Importance of Accurate Invoicing

Invoices must follow a standard structure that includes GSTIN, tax breakup, and applicable tax rates. Even small errors can cause return mismatches or rejected input credits. Filing Returns on Time

GST returns must be filed monthly or quarterly depending on the scheme selected. Missing deadlines results in late fees and interest, increasing financial pressure. Timely filing also ensures uninterrupted compliance history, which is essential during audits or loan applications.

Managing Input Tax Credit Correctly

Input tax credit reduces overall tax liability, but it must be claimed only when supplier data matches buyer records. Regular reconciliation helps prevent credit reversals. Record Maintenance and Documentation

Proper documentation of sales, purchases, expenses, and tax filings is mandatory. These records must be preserved for audits and assessments. Organized accounting systems reduce stress during inspections and support long-term business stability.
